Travis Smith is a seasoned security and threat operations leader with over a decade of experience blending digital forensics, incident response, and enterprise software delivery. Currently VP of ML Threat Operations at HiddenLayer, he has led threat research and malware teams at Qualys and Tripwire, driving product-focused R&D and adoption across global customers. Known for translating deep technical research into practical defensive tools, he has a history of building network and endpoint security architectures from the ground up. An experienced public speaker with repeated appearances at Black Hat, DEF CON, RSA and BSides, he communicates complex adversary tradecraft to both technical and executive audiences. His background in compliance, logging, and automated security operations pairs an MBA in information assurance with hands-on engineering and sales experience. Colleagues describe him as entrepreneurial and relentless at finding ways to excel in new challenges, often turning proof-of-concept work into production-ready defenses.
